The manufacture of high quality Goodyear welted shoes remains labour-intensive. It requires a highly skilled workforce to carry out more than 200 separate operations during an 8 week period. Web15 de jul. de 2013 · Northampton boomed in the 19th century, with the boot and shoe industry dominating the town and county. By 1841 there were 1,821 shoemakers in Northampton. Northampton continued to prosper particularly during World War One producing millions of boots for the Forces of Britain and its allies.
